MSc in International Business
An MSc in International Business is a postgraduate degree program that typically spans one to two years. This program is designed to equip students with the knowledge and skills necessary to navigate the complexities of global business environments. It focuses on international trade, cross-cultural management, global marketing, and international finance, preparing graduates for careers in multinational corporations and global markets.
Topics Covered in an MSc in International Business Program:
- International Marketing
- Global Supply Chain Management
- Cross-Cultural Management
- International Trade and Economics
- Global Business Strategy
- International Finance
- Business Research Methods
- Emerging Markets
- Sustainability in International Business

Career Opportunities for MSc in International Business Graduates:
- International Business Manager
- Global Marketing Manager
- International Trade Specialist
- Business Development Manager
- International Financial Analyst
- Cross-Cultural Consultant
- Supply Chain Manager
- Export/Import Manager
